3. Aim of the Course
This course is unique opportunity for young physicians and nurses to get the latest developments in
h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(HSCT) in children and adolescents and an opportunity of
addressing adapted approaches in developing countries. Very few centres of HSCT are in place in Africa and
Arab countries. Keeping with the mission of European Group for Blood and Marrow Transplantation (EBMT)
to promote and facilitate access to state-of-the-art and 7877cutting-edge knowledge in blood and marrow
transplantation the course will explore the major issues impacting on HSCT in children and adolescents.
Targeted audience
Many leading paediatric haematologists/oncologists are included among the speakers; the course is
addressed specifically to postgraduate/resident level young physicians and paediatric nurses.
Participation will be limited to 100.
Submitted abstracts will be scored and best abstracts will be prized. Participants presenting selected
abstracts will be awarded with grants covering registration and housing.
